资源简介:
本源码资源是一个基于ArcGIS API for JavaScript开发的地图操作系统,专为实现地理空间数据的可视化和交互而设计。该系统采用三层架构,前端通过API与后端进行数据请求,实现高效的数据管理和展示。用户可以根据实际需求,将经纬度数据动态填充到地图上,直观展现地理信息。
- 核心功能:
- 支持通过经纬度坐标将空间数据渲染到地图,实现点、线、面等多种地理要素的可视化。
- 内置简单易用的测距和测面积工具,方便用户在地图上直接进行距离和面积的快速计算。
- 集成基于gridobj的分页查询功能,有效提升大规模空间数据检索与展示的效率。
- 技术特点:
- 采用ArcGIS API for JavaScript,保证了良好的跨平台兼容性与丰富的地图交互能力。
- 三层架构设计(表现层、逻辑层、数据层),结构清晰,有利于系统扩展与维护。
- 支持灵活的数据请求方式,可对接多种后端数据库或服务接口,实现动态加载与更新。
- 适用场景:
- 地理信息系统(GIS)应用开发,如城市规划、土地管理、环境监测等领域。
- 需要对空间数据进行可视化分析和交互操作的业务系统。
- 教育科研中地理空间实验教学及相关演示项目。
- 使用优势:
- 简化了复杂地理空间操作流程,用户无需深入底层即可实现常见地图功能。
- 模块化设计便于二次开发,可根据实际需求拓展更多自定义工具或分析方法。
总结:
本资源为开发者提供了一套高效实用的地图操作解决方案,涵盖了从基础的数据填充到常用空间量算工具,并结合分页查询优化大数据处理体验。适合希望快速搭建具备专业地理信息处理能力Web应用的团队和个人。